Design de múltiplas provas do OP Stack: Aumentar a segurança e flexibilidade do L2

robot
Geração do resumo em andamento

Aplicação do design de múltiplas provas na OP Stack

As vantagens de segurança das redes de múltiplos clientes são bem conhecidas, mas e se a sua L2 favorita pudesse integrar múltiplos esquemas de prova em seu design? Esta é a situação após a atualização da rede principal OP para Bedrock.

Seguindo o princípio de que a diversidade de clientes é benéfica para o ecossistema blockchain, o OP Stack transforma a mainnet OP em uma blockchain modular, ao mesmo tempo que suporta a diversidade de esquemas de prova. Ao utilizar o design modular do OP Stack e do Bedrock, os desenvolvedores podem rapidamente aproveitar vários tipos de provas existentes e garantir que o sistema possa se adaptar a inovações futuras em provas.

Vamos explorar em profundidade os aspectos técnicos desta funcionalidade única e discutir seu amplo impacto no ecossistema.

Desafios da solução de prova no design de Rollup

Anteriormente, a iteração do design rollup concentrou-se principalmente na criação de uma única prova e na adaptação do sistema a ela. Esta abordagem limita a flexibilidade e a adaptabilidade do sistema às tecnologias em constante mudança. Devido a esta linha de pensamento de design, o mercado L2 debate-se principalmente em torno de provas otimistas e provas de validade.

Ao projetar o "Bedrock", desejávamos mudar essa situação. Colocamos a modularidade como o princípio de design central da atualização do Bedrock, construindo um sistema que pode se adaptar a vários tipos de provas, oferecendo aos desenvolvedores soluções de prova mais seguras e com maior visão de futuro.

Solução: Design modular, flexibilidade e segurança

A capacidade de integrar várias provas na OP Stack trouxe muitos benefícios, sendo a segurança o mais proeminente. Ter várias provas pode evitar que qualquer erro numa única prova se torne uma fraqueza letal. Isso é semelhante a como várias implementações de clientes L1 oferecem uma melhor segurança geral. Vitalik escreveu sobre como a ideia de múltiplos clientes da Ethereum interage com o zk-evm. Ele apontou que a implementação de múltiplos clientes é uma forma de descentralização técnica, cuja principal vantagem é a capacidade de resistir a erros na rede. Se várias equipes ou partes interessadas independentes mantiverem uma implementação, isso também levará a uma forma de descentralização social. Os interesses de cada equipe são considerados no roteiro da rede.

O design modular do Bedrock já gerou várias implementações de clientes L2 no ecossistema Optimism, o que é pioneiro no campo L2. Estamos expandindo essa ideia, permitindo que o OP Stack inclua várias provas. Isso abre caminho para a adição de provas de validade de conhecimento zero (ZK) à mainnet OP ou a outras chains OP (como Base), garantindo compatibilidade com desenvolvimentos futuros. O design modular do OP Stack permite a adoção fácil de novas tecnologias em um ambiente seguro e testado em campo, sem a necessidade de grandes alterações no código.

Princípio de funcionamento

O sistema de provas no OP Stack é modular através de APIs on-chain padronizadas e participantes off-chain. Isso permite a combinação de contratos de disputa, facilitando a troca de esquemas de prova.

API em cadeia padronizada

Através de APIs on-chain padronizadas, o Bedrock torna possíveis os esquemas de prova de troca, desde que implementem as APIs padronizadas. Isso significa que novos esquemas de prova podem ser adicionados dinamicamente, e podemos até criar um esquema m-of-n, no qual múltiplos esquemas de prova são necessários para operar a ponte.

participantes externos padronizados

Os participantes off-chain ou robôs comunicam-se com contratos em disputa. O sistema cria oportunidades de Máximo Valor Extraível (MEV) para incentivar comportamentos honestos e proteger o sistema, enquanto mantém o princípio de que a participação em jogos de disputa deve sempre ser lucrativa, para garantir sua continuidade. Através deste modelo, estamos a criar uma rede aberta de participantes de monitorização, que podem intervir para resolver disputas, a fim de garantir a segurança do sistema.

Atualmente, estão em estudo a implementação de dois tipos de participantes padronizados fora da cadeia.

O futuro pertence à Super Chain

A atualização do Bedrock e seu suporte para múltiplas provas estão alinhados com nossa visão de uma rede escalável que não compromete o ecossistema, aplicativos ou a capacidade de colaborar. Sendo o único ecossistema L2 projetado para a simplicidade de múltiplos clientes e múltiplas provas, a Optimism liderará a indústria em direção a um futuro mais seguro, adaptável, colaborativo e otimista.

OP-5.68%
Ver original
Esta página pode conter conteúdo de terceiros, que é fornecido apenas para fins informativos (não para representações/garantias) e não deve ser considerada como um endosso de suas opiniões pela Gate nem como aconselhamento financeiro ou profissional. Consulte a Isenção de responsabilidade para obter detalhes.
  • Recompensa
  • 11
  • Compartilhar
Comentário
0/400
GweiWatchervip
· 31m atrás
op esta onda é realmente top
Ver originalResponder0
GateUser-2fce706cvip
· 07-30 22:54
Todo mundo ainda está olhando para as altcoins. Eu já disse que L2 é o ponto alto. Já estou me preparando para isso há três anos.
Ver originalResponder0
ConfusedWhalevip
· 07-30 16:34
É só enrolar e tá feito, quem entende isso?
Ver originalResponder0
TurnBadLuckIntoGoodvip
· 07-30 05:07
Esta tendência de cair, Força! Liderando a corrente
Ver originalResponder0
BlockchainDecodervip
· 07-30 05:00
De acordo com os dados existentes, a contribuição da prova múltipla para a melhoria do indicador TPS ainda precisa ser comprovada.
Ver originalResponder0
LightningSentryvip
· 07-30 04:59
Wow, esta onda OP até à lua!
Ver originalResponder0
SelfCustodyIssuesvip
· 07-30 04:54
Já estão a brincar com novas ideias, será que é realmente fiável?
Ver originalResponder0
PancakeFlippavip
· 07-30 04:45
op Rede principal está estável.
Ver originalResponder0
GreenCandleCollectorvip
· 07-30 04:38
Vamos ter uma prova múltipla, hmm? Este aumento eu gosto.
Ver originalResponder0
DevChivevip
· 07-30 04:38
A solução é tão estável quanto um cão velho.
Ver originalResponder0
Ver projetos
Faça trade de criptomoedas em qualquer lugar e a qualquer hora
qrCode
Escaneie o código para baixar o app da Gate
Comunidade
Português (Brasil)
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)